Background: Common Problems Owners Face
In the vibrant and rapidly developing region of Bali, construction projects are a common sight. From residential buildings and hotels to commercial spaces and infrastructure developments, the island has seen an unprecedented surge in building activities over the past decade. However, beneath this booming construction industry lies a complex web of challenges that often result in substandard structures, putting both lives and investments at risk. One of the primary issues faced by property owners is the lack of oversight during the construction phase. Many developers or homeowners do not have the expertise to monitor contractors’ adherence to building codes and standards. This can lead to several critical problems:
Substandard Materials
Construction materials are often sourced from local suppliers who may cut corners for cost savings. For instance, steel bars used in reinforced concrete structures might be of lower quality than specified, compromising the structural integrity. In Bali, where earthquakes are not uncommon due to its proximity to the Sunda Fault Zone, such suboptimal materials can have catastrophic consequences.
Lack of Compliance with Building Codes
Building codes and standards exist for a reason—to ensure safety in construction. However, many contractors either ignore these guidelines or modify them without proper justification. For example, some may reduce the number of concrete reinforcement layers to speed up work or save costs. Such practices can significantly weaken the structural capacity of buildings.
Poor Quality Control
Quality control during construction is often overlooked. Inspections might be superficial and conducted infrequently, leading to undetected defects in the structure. This is particularly concerning when it comes to critical components like foundation works and waterproofing systems. A faulty foundation or inadequate waterproofing can lead to long-term structural issues such as settlement, cracking, and water leaks.
Unqualified Contractors
The construction industry in Bali is known for its high turnover of workers, with many unlicensed contractors taking on projects. These individuals often lack the necessary experience, knowledge, and skills to ensure a safe and structurally sound building. Their work can introduce unforeseen risks that may only become apparent after the structure has been completed.
Delayed Project Inspections
Timely inspections are crucial for identifying and rectifying issues early in the construction process. However, many projects suffer from delays due to bureaucratic processes or poor planning by developers. These delays can result in incomplete or rushed inspections, leaving potential safety hazards unaddressed.
Environmental Considerations
Bali’s unique environmental conditions further complicate the issue of safe structural construction. The island's soil types, particularly its expansive clay soils and soft alluvial deposits, require specific foundation designs to prevent subsidence and settlement issues. Without proper design and supervision, these problems can arise, leading to costly repairs or even building collapse.

Material Verification
Ensuring the quality of construction materials is another critical component of our services. We conduct rigorous inspections of raw materials before they are incorporated into projects. For instance, we test concrete samples for compressive strength and analyze steel bars for their tensile properties using state-of-the-art laboratory equipment. Quality Control and Inspection
Our commitment to quality control extends beyond material verification. We implement a robust inspection regime throughout the construction process, including regular site visits by experienced engineers. These inspections cover multiple aspects: - **Foundation Works**: Ensuring proper excavation depth, compaction, and drainage systems. - **Reinforcement Placement**: Verifying correct placement of steel reinforcements to meet design specifications. - **Pouring Procedures**: Monitoring concrete pouring techniques to ensure uniformity and density. - **Waterproofing Systems**: Conducting detailed checks on waterproof membranes and coatings.
